2002 BMW 5 Series - Expensive, but worth it
Overall my M5 has been a wonderful car. I love the power of my BMW M5. I opted for the post face lift version which includes projector headlights and Celis tail lights. The E39 M5 is the last hand built M car ever produced. The power feels limitless. No matter which gear I'm in I always get pushed into my seat when I punch the gas. The interior is very solid and nothing is damaged inside even being 12 years old. The cabin is nice and quiet on the highway yet I still get that gorgeous roar from the V8 at high RPMs. The ride on the highway is very smooth for a 12 year old 340 rwhp family sedan.
Story
I have walked so many people in this thing. From a dig it just hooks up and flys.
Pros
The power and looks are the two most mentionable pros for this car. The design of this car really is timeless.
Cons
The parts are getting too expensive for me to justify the ownership anymore. I have spent more money in parts over the past couple of years than the car is worth. Granted, you don't own one of these things for its economic features.
2002 BMW 5 Series - Love it, expensive if not well maintained
Overall, I love the car. If it's in your price range, I would recommend it completely. The car does well on the road and would be great for a single adult or as a family car. The cabin is spacious as well as the large trunk, designed to fit 3 full size golf bags (for comparison). The propulsion is smooth and there is little sound from the engine inside the cabin whether in the city or on county roads.
Pros
Features & Luxury. Although the car is a 2002, it meets or exceeds many current lower price range cars. Many of the features make the cabin of the car a very comfortable experience for short or long drives. It's warm in the winter and remains cool even in summer.
Style, The car is known for its look, but the interior and exterior are beautiful. The sleek design is aerodynamic, yet retains the legacy of the brand. Interior is grey leather with black dash and a dark laminate wood trim.
Cons
Performance in winter (snow). As the car is rear-wheel drive there are some problems to be had in inclement weather.
Gas mileage. If you're concerned about mileage, the car averages around 18 city and 28 highway in mostly hill/mountain terrain. The car is very heavy, but sports a lot of power to make up for it.
